本文围绕区块链技术展开全面解析,涵盖原理、特点与应用前景,在原理方面,深入探究其分布式账本、加密算法等核心构成,特点上,强调去中心化、不可篡改、安全透明等优势,这些特性让区块链在数据存储与传输上更具可靠性,应用前景十分广阔,在金融、供应链、医疗等众多领域都有巨大潜力,可提升效率、降低成本、增强信任,随着技术的不断发展,区块链有望重塑各行业的业务模式与生态,推动社会经济的创新变革。
在当今这个数字化浪潮以磅礴之势迅猛发展的时代,区块链技术宛如一颗在浩瀚星空中冉冉升起的璀璨新星,格外引人注目,吸引着全球各界投来热切的目光,它最初仅是作为比特币的底层技术初露锋芒,然而经过岁月的沉淀与发展,如今已在金融、医疗、供应链等众多领域展现出令人惊叹的巨大应用潜力,区块链正凭借其独特的魅力,如同一位技艺高超的工匠,精心重塑着我们的社会和经济模式,本文将全方位、深层次地对区块链技术展开介绍,抽丝剥茧般深入剖析其原理、特点以及广阔的应用前景。
区块链技术的基本概念
区块链,本质上是一种先进的分布式账本技术,它巧妙地将数据以区块的形式进行存储,每个区块如同一个装满信息的“小盒子”,里面包含了一定时间内的交易信息以及前一个区块的哈希值,通过哈希值这一神奇的“纽带”,各个区块依次紧密连接起来,形成一条宛如链条般的数据结构,这种独特的结构赋予了区块链中的数据高度的不可篡改性和可追溯性,就像给数据加上了一把坚固的“安全锁”。
区块链的核心原理
分布式账本
分布式账本就像是一个由众多参与者共同维护的“大账本”,在这个体系中,数据并非存储在单一的中心化服务器上,而是由网络中的多个节点共同持有和维护,每个节点都拥有一份完整的账本副本,如同每个参与者都有一本相同的记录册,当有新的交易发生时,节点会如同严谨的审计员一般对交易进行验证,并将其记录到自己的账本中,这种分布式的特性使得区块链具有更高的可靠性和容错性,即便部分节点出现故障或遭受攻击,整个系统仍能像一台精密的机器一样正常运行,不受太大影响。
加密技术
区块链运用先进的加密算法来精心守护数据的安全性和隐私性,哈希算法犹如一个神奇的“魔法转换器”,可以将任意长度的数据转换为固定长度的哈希值,不同的数据会产生独一无二的哈希值,而且通过哈希值无法反向推导出原始数据,就像把数据变成了一个难以破解的“密码”,公私钥加密技术则用于验证交易的合法性和进行身份认证,用户拥有一对公私钥,公钥如同一个公开的“邮箱地址”,用于接收交易;私钥则像是一把私密的“钥匙”,用于签署交易,只有持有私钥的用户才能对交易进行签名和授权,确保了交易的安全性和唯一性。
共识机制
共识机制是区块链网络中节点达成一致的规则和方法,由于区块链网络中的节点是分散的,没有一个中心化的权威机构来进行协调,因此需要一种机制来确保所有节点对账本的状态达成共识,常见的共识机制有工作量证明(PoW)、权益证明(PoS)、委托权益证明(DPoS)等,工作量证明要求节点通过计算复杂的数学难题来竞争记账权,就像一场激烈的“智力竞赛”,第一个解决难题的节点可以将新的区块添加到区块链中,并获得一定的奖励,权益证明则根据节点持有的代币数量来分配记账权,持有代币越多的节点获得记账权的概率越大,如同在一场选举中,拥有更多“选票”的人更有可能当选。
区块链的特点
去中心化
去中心化是区块链最为显著的特点之一,传统的中心化系统就像一个由少数几个“指挥官”掌控的军队,依赖于一个或少数几个中心机构来管理和控制数据,而区块链通过分布式账本和共识机制实现了数据的去中心化存储和管理,如同将权力分散到众多参与者手中,这意味着没有任何一个机构或个人可以完全控制区块链网络,从而避免了单点故障和中心化机构可能出现的腐败问题,让整个系统更加公平、公正、稳定。
不可篡改
由于区块链中的每个区块都包含了前一个区块的哈希值,一旦某个区块的数据被篡改,其哈希值就会像多米诺骨牌一样发生连锁变化,从而导致后续所有区块的哈希值都需要重新计算,在一个庞大的区块链网络中,要篡改大量节点上的账本数据几乎是不可能完成的任务,因此区块链中的数据具有高度的不可篡改性,就像给数据建立了一座坚不可摧的“堡垒”。
透明性
区块链中的交易信息是公开透明的,所有节点都可以像查看一本公开的“日记”一样查看和验证交易的真实性,但同时,用户的身份信息是通过加密技术进行保护的,只有在必要的情况下才能进行解密和验证,这种透明性与隐私保护的完美平衡使得区块链在保证交易安全的同时,也提高了交易的可信度和可追溯性,让交易更加阳光、透明。
智能合约
智能合约是一种自动执行的合约,它以代码的形式存储在区块链上,就像一个不知疲倦的“机器人”,当满足预设的条件时,智能合约会自动执行相应的条款,无需人工干预,智能合约可以广泛应用于各种领域,如金融交易、供应链管理、知识产权保护等,大大提高了交易的效率和可靠性,让交易变得更加便捷、高效。
区块链的应用前景
金融领域
区块链技术在金融领域的应用已经取得了令人瞩目的显著成果,它可以实现跨境支付的快速、低成本和安全,传统的跨境支付就像一场漫长而复杂的“接力赛”,需要经过多个中间机构,手续繁琐、费用高且到账时间长,而区块链可以直接连接付款方和收款方,实现点对点的支付,如同搭建了一座直接的“桥梁”,大大缩短了支付时间和降低了成本,区块链还可以用于证券交易、数字货币发行、征信等领域,为金融行业带来了全新的变革。
医疗领域
在医疗领域,区块链可以成为医疗数据的“守护者”和“共享者”,患者的医疗记录、诊断结果、基因数据等可以存储在区块链上,实现数据的安全共享和授权访问,这不仅可以提高医疗效率,减少医疗差错,还可以促进医学研究和药物研发,为医疗行业的发展注入新的活力。
供应链管理
区块链技术可以实现供应链的全程追溯和可视化,通过在区块链上记录产品的生产、运输、销售等各个环节的信息,消费者可以像查看产品的“成长日记”一样清楚地了解产品的来源和质量,企业也可以更好地管理供应链,提高供应链的效率和透明度,让供应链变得更加高效、可靠。
区块链技术作为一种具有革命性的创新技术,以其去中心化、不可篡改、透明性等独特特点,为各个领域的发展带来了新的机遇和挑战,虽然目前区块链技术还面临着一些技术难题和监管问题,但随着技术的不断进步和应用的不断拓展,相信区块链将在未来的社会和经济发展中发挥越来越重要的作用,我们有理由满怀期待,区块链技术将为我们创造一个更加安全、高效、透明的数字世界,引领我们走向更加美好的未来。